IIS新手指南:強化IIS以抵禦攻擊
在當今的數位時代,網站安全性變得越來越重要。對於使用Internet Information Services(IIS)作為其網頁伺服器的用戶來說,了解如何強化IIS以抵禦各種攻擊是至關重要的。本文將探討一些有效的策略和最佳實踐,以幫助新手用戶加強其IIS伺服器的安全性。
1. 更新IIS和Windows系統
保持IIS和Windows系統的最新狀態是防止攻擊的第一步。微軟定期發布安全更新和補丁,以修補已知的漏洞。用戶應定期檢查並安裝這些更新,以確保系統不易受到攻擊。
2. 配置防火牆
防火牆是保護伺服器的重要工具。用戶應配置Windows防火牆,僅允許必要的端口(如80和443)通過。可以使用以下步驟來配置防火牆:
- 打開控制面板,選擇「系統和安全」。
- 點擊「Windows Defender防火牆」。
- 選擇「高級設定」,然後創建新的入站規則。
3. 禁用不必要的功能
IIS提供了許多功能,但並非所有功能都對每個網站都是必要的。禁用不必要的功能可以減少潛在的攻擊面。例如,如果不需要FTP功能,可以將其禁用。這可以通過IIS管理器進行:
- 打開IIS管理器,選擇伺服器節點。
- 在「功能視圖」中,找到「管理」部分,然後選擇「功能關聯」。
- 禁用不必要的功能。
4. 使用SSL/TLS加密
使用SSL/TLS加密可以保護網站與用戶之間的數據傳輸。這不僅能提高網站的安全性,還能增強用戶的信任感。用戶可以通過以下步驟在IIS中安裝SSL證書:
- 獲取SSL證書,通常可以通過受信任的證書頒發機構(CA)獲得。
- 在IIS管理器中,選擇網站,然後點擊「綁定」。
- 添加HTTPS綁定,並選擇安裝的SSL證書。
5. 實施IP限制
通過限制訪問伺服器的IP地址,可以進一步增強安全性。用戶可以在IIS中設置IP地址和域名限制,以允許或拒絕特定的IP地址訪問網站。這可以通過以下步驟完成:
- 在IIS管理器中,選擇網站,然後點擊「IP地址和域名限制」。
- 添加允許或拒絕的IP地址。
6. 監控和日誌記錄
定期監控伺服器的日誌可以幫助用戶及早發現潛在的安全問題。IIS提供了詳細的日誌記錄功能,用戶可以啟用並配置日誌記錄,以便跟踪訪問和錯誤信息。
總結
強化IIS以抵禦攻擊是一個持續的過程,涉及多個方面的安全措施。通過定期更新系統、配置防火牆、禁用不必要的功能、使用SSL/TLS加密、實施IP限制以及監控日誌記錄,用戶可以顯著提高其IIS伺服器的安全性。對於尋求穩定和安全的虛擬伺服器解決方案的用戶,香港VPS 提供了多種選擇,幫助用戶在保護數據的同時,確保網站的高效運行。